Output b94e224db605df63cbf70a3b62791e48baef2b67eacb5e98f957258538b4c88c:1

value
153957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bdf16a7acbe40ffc17d267c6e3354c33e4dcf65 OP_EQUAL
address
3JpPXsnkivaMHt4rwh2F8jhVC5y9G39y2V
transaction
b94e224db605df63cbf70a3b62791e48baef2b67eacb5e98f957258538b4c88c
confirmations
350446
spent
true